# Batching constants for the Fieldfork GraphQL resolver layer.
#
# Reviewer notes: the original resolver issued one query per node,
# producing the classic N+1 pattern on the `orders.items` edge.
# We now collect keys per tick and dispatch a single batched query
# through the Quillcache loader. Batch size and flush timing trade
# latency against database load; the values below were chosen from
# staging benchmarks and are documented as follows.

tuning table, yajog-yahof:
BUDGETS = {
    "lamvan": 303,
    "wenox": 460,
    "fenvan": 525,
}

Title: Shrinkray CLI drops alpha channel when resizing PNGs in batch mode

When Shrinkray processes a directory containing transparent PNGs with --batch, output files have a black background where transparency was. Single-file mode preserves alpha correctly, so the bug is likely in the batch worker's pixel-format conversion. Repro: any RGBA PNG, width target 800. Affects 1.4.2 and later; 1.4.1 is fine. Please review the proposed fix in the linked branch. The regression was introduced in the build identified below.

pipeline stamp: htk3_69f

Subject: Key rotation — fleet fuel-usage reporting

Hi, and welcome aboard. We rotated credentials for the Haulwright fuel-usage report pipeline this morning as part of routine quarterly rotation. The old key stops working Friday at noon. Please update your local config before then; the report generator will fail silently otherwise. Everything else about the Tankerline endpoint is unchanged. Your new key for the reporting service follows.

service key, fafop-kaguf: vxb7-m3DSNYe

### Summary

Adds the Nightloom scheduler for nightly backfill jobs on the Cinderpath warehouse. Jobs are sharded by partition date and throttled to avoid starving the morning report pipeline. Retries use capped exponential backoff, and concurrency is bounded per source table. The defaults shipping with this PR are as follows.

tuning table, fahop-kajof:
QUOTAS = {
    "ulaath": 5,
    "wenwyn": 2,
    "quenwyn": 10,
    "quenix": 1,
}